#4a6947 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4a6947 is composed of 29% red, 41.2%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.4%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 114.7 degrees, a saturation of 19.3% and a lightness of 34.5%. #4a6947 color hex could be obtained by blending #94d28e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#4a6947 color description : Very dark grayish lime green.

#4a6947 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4a6947 has RGB values of R:74, G:105, B:71 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0, Y:0.32,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 4876615.

Shades and Tints of #4a6947

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080b08 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4a6947

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555b55 is the less saturated color, while #12ad03 is the most saturated one.
